I have a  question. I am monitoring my IIS and disk space usage using SCOM 2012. What I want to do is for these alerts and these alerts only to appear in Service Manager 2012. I have configured the connector between SCOM and Service Manager. I want this to be an automatic process. I can see the alerts in SCOM but not in SM. Only if I right click on the alert in SCOM and forward it to the internal connector, then only it appears under All Open SCOM incidents in SM. So my questions are:

  1. How can I configure this process to be automatic?
  2. Where by default in SM does the SCOM alerts go
  3. What I really want to achieve is that once these alerts are logged, for orchestrator to fire up a runbook and remediate these (restart IIS and delete some files on the server which has raised the alert ). Once the alert has a resolution state of closed, I want this to be marked as resolved/closed in SM. Can someone please give me some directions on this?
